BANGKOK: The Maya Bay, made world-famous after Leonardo DiCaprio's movie "The Beach", will remain closed as rehabilitation of the popular beach continues after enormous corals were destroyed through excess tourism.
The Ministry of Natural Resources and Environment said that in future ships will not be allowed to enter Maya Bay, except from the back.
